For the 2025 school year, there are 4 public schools serving 1,439 students in Nadaburg Unified School District (4252). This district's average testing ranking is 6/10, which is in the top 50% of public schools in Arizona.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ø Schools in Nadaburg Unified School District (4252) have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the Arizona public school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 38% (versus the 41%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 48%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Arizona public school average of 66% (majority Hispanic).

Nadaburg Unified School District (4252), which is ranked within the top 50% of all 603 school districts in Arizona (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 85-89% has increased from 80-84%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$7,809 in this school district is less than the state median of $11,421. The school district revenue/student has declined by 44%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$8,906 is less than the state median of $11,323. The school district spending/student has declined by 44% over four school years.
